The microstrip antenna is a good candidate for a SAR antenna at C-band and X-band frequencies as it meets the requirements for bandwidth, crosspolar and gain. It is relatively unaffected by temperature as its bandwidth is broad enough to tolerate effects caused by temperature. In addition, the manufacture of such an antenna is significantly cheaper when compared to other radiators. The processes developed at DASA Dornier are quick and repeatable. The light weight of the antenna (3 kg per square meter, including connectors but without backing structure) makes it particularly attractive for space applications.
